Garland is actually a big Dark Souls and Elden Ring fan, he's been talking about them for years. Dark Souls II was shown being played in the background by a character in Devs for instance. I imagine if he's writing as well as directing then he was part of getting this off the ground rather than just being hired for the project.

And interestingly he talked directly about how a game like Dark Souls would be hard to adapt into a film because they're very rooted in being video games and being very abstract and loose plotwise
https://www.gamespot.com/articles/devs-creator-alex-garland-on-why-video-game-movies/1100-6478904/
>As for Garland's other favorite franchise, Dark Souls, he's less confident about the potential for an adaptation, largely because of the mood and ambiance the Souls games tend to have. "The Dark Souls games seem to have this embedded poetry in them. You'll be wandering around and find some weird bit of dialogue with some sort of broken song sat with a bit of armor outside a doorway and it feels like you've drifted into some existential dream. That's what I really love about Dark Souls. These spaces are so imaginative and they seem to flow into each other and flow out of each other [...] I can't imagine how that would [be adapted]. The quality that makes Dark Souls special is probably unique to video games."
So I guess he's worked out what he thinks is a way to make it work. Civil War kind of had this a bit, in that rather than being an elaborate plot, it was more like a series of small vignettes as the characters travelled across the country. That'd work for Elden Ring.

>>737329631
Directed by, yes. Written by Garland, they also had the same partnership on Sunshine and 28 Years Later recently. Boyle had previously adapted Garland's novel The Beach as a film.
Garland was an author and screenwriter up until the 2010s when he moved into directing as well, with Dredd (officially directed by Pete Travis, but an open secret that Garland wound up unofficially being the actual director) and Ex Machina.

>I imagine if he's writing as well as directing then he was part of getting this off the ground rather than just being hired for the project.
It was him who pursued it
>director Alex Garland privately shared his experience playing Elden Ring with A24's head of film, Noah Sacco, impressing him to support pursuing an adaptation. After Garland wrote a 160-page spec script, accompanied by forty pages of imagery, Sacco flew him to Japan to sign a deal with FromSoftware, the developer of the game
Miyazaki said previously he was open to adaptations of Elden Ring to other medium as long as it was a strong partner, so I'm guessing Garland being a fan saw an opening to jump in and get A24 on board. They produced his last three films, and Ex Machina, his directorial debut.

Garland if nothing else seems to be genuinely into the game and pursued it with both A24 and From
>Garland presented a 160-page script, complete with 40 illustrated pages, and personally traveled to Japan to meet the FromSoftware president.
>Miyazaki, who rarely approves outside adaptations, was reportedly impressed not just by the script itself but also by Garland’s encyclopedic knowledge of Elden Ring’s lore and mechanics. That was enough to earn the project his blessing, putting the adaptation into official production.
>The New Yorker reports that A24 CEO Noah Sacco was first convinced when Garland showed him Elden Ring gameplay on his own screen.

I would agree that Men does not pan out into a great film, but it's not for any reason that I'd be concerned about for Elden Ring. It looked nice, it sounded nice, and it was memorably gruesome with some strong atmosphere. Where it failed was the screenplay which seemed underdeveloped and needed another few drafts, it introduces a hodgepodge of psychological and mythological ideas but they don't really amount to anything concrete and it seemed like he wasn't sure what it added up to so the third act winds up just relying on some gross body horror then a quick ending.

With all that said, I don't think that is too big an issue with Elden Ring, because where it was strong, are areas that would also be strong in an Elden Ring film, except for the action element, which going by Dredd, Civil War and Warfare, may turn out just fine as well, those films had really great sound design and editing for action. Likewise for Annihilation and Civil War, I'd look at them and see points in favor of him trying Elden Ring, since I think a film needs to nail a dreamy, eerie atmosphere, with off-kilter characters, as well as not spend loads of time just info dumping, but simply throw the viewer into the world and let it speak for itself. Civil War was good at that, just having the characters go across the wartorn country and experience different little stories and vignettes, rather than concentrating on plot, which is not where a good Elden Ring film is gonna be found if you ask me (and not necessarily where a good Garland film is found either)

But that's his forte, hit or miss, his background is in writing novels and screenplays, he only got into directing as well with Ex Machina in 2014 (and unofficially with Dredd in 2012 which he isn't credited as director for but it's apparently an open secret he was pretty much the real director on).

Some have pointed to David Lowery's adaptation of The Green Knight from 2021 as a blueprint for how to adapt From Software's style, and I can see the merits there, though that one might be a little too esoteric and artsy, after all, Dark Souls and Elden Ring are still action-adventure games, you do need some kind of strong action element, so it can't just be slow weird fantasy visuals. We'll see what his approach is. I would hope he marries his style of dreamy, uncanny atmospheres (found in Devs, Annihilation and Men), with his pechant for throwing you in the deep end and just depicting a single tale in an existing world that's not delved into too much (like Civil War and Warfare). The former in particular has a lot of little vignettes in it that would work with Elden Ring NPCs, weird little fragments of stories you get a partial impression of then move on.

It it goes wrong, it'll likely be in trying to do too much of the game and being choppy or overstuffed, or from not being able to realize the fantasy visuals. It has a better chance then stuff like Mario which was clearly conceived to be basic kids flick stuff from the start, or stuff like Zelda which is a hard game to adapt to film while keeping it feeling like Zelda, and not just a generic fantasy film, tonally I expect that film to not quite capture Zelda's slight quirkiness and be a bit dry even if it has the costumes pretty accurate by the looks of it. On the stance of strangeness, I'd say some of Garland's films do have unexpected tones, 28 Years Later and The Bone Temple just recently have some oddball stuff that was surprising, in a good way for me, but maybe not for everyone.
